The Final Minutes: Where Legends are Made

The final minutes of the Brazil vs. Croatia game were nothing short of legendary. Honestly, I was on the edge of my seat! Extra time was already underway, and the score was still locked at 0-0 after a grueling 90 minutes. The tension was so thick you could cut it with a knife. Both teams were visibly exhausted, their players running on fumes, but the dream of reaching the semi-finals fueled their every step.

Then, in the dying moments of the first half of extra time, Neymar produced a moment of pure magic. After a series of intricate passes and lightning-fast footwork, he weaved his way through the Croatian defense, rounded the goalkeeper, and slotted the ball into the net. The stadium erupted, the Brazilian fans went wild, and it seemed like their passage to the next round was sealed. It was a goal worthy of winning any game, a testament to Neymar's brilliance and his ability to deliver in the clutch. But Croatia are not a team to be easily defeated. They have a never-say-die attitude, a resilience that has seen them through countless challenges. And they weren't about to give up, not now, not ever.

With just minutes remaining in the second half of extra time, Croatia launched one final attack. A hopeful ball was played into the Brazilian penalty area, and after a scramble, the ball fell to Bruno Petković, who unleashed a powerful shot that took a deflection and flew past the helpless Alisson. The Croatian fans erupted, their hopes reignited, and the momentum shifted dramatically. It was a goal that defied the odds, a goal that showcased Croatia's fighting spirit, and a goal that sent the game to a penalty shootout. The final minutes of extra time were a blur of frantic attacks, desperate defending, and heart-stopping moments. Both teams threw everything they had at each other, but neither could find a winner. The players were cramping, exhausted, and emotionally drained, but they knew that their World Cup fate would be decided by the dreaded penalty shootout.
